People on here really throw all their empathy for female characters out the window if she makes a decision they don't like.

There is no such thing as a perfect victim. And "right or wrong" is not so black and white. Trauma responses can often be detrimental to the person experiencing it and the people around them. It's well established that Yifan's response is to hide/runaway.
Add on top of that, being scared that her uncle will continue to target the people around her, I think many people would choose to distance themselves in that situation too.
How many male leads have we seen suddenly turn distant or cruel in order to make an FL leave them in order to protect her? Not saying it's a great trope but at least here it's not just machismo but also something deeper rooted that has nothing to do with Sang Yan at all. & I am glad that even though he is hurt (& he does deserve feel hurt) he isn't making her trauma about himself.

Even though it's painful, it's somewhat refreshing to see a story where falling in love doesn't magically make trauma vanish.

Do I wish she would have just taken the leap and told him everything so he could help her? Of course. But it's not just about trust either.


Anyway I hope Yifan and Sangyan can have their uninterrupted happiness soon

Title The Best Thing Spoiler
Should her going abroad be such a deal breaker? Sometimes they make these choices a little extreme.
i do agree a lot of modern dramas make mundane things seem like life or death to make the stakes feel higher. for example i was recently watching Go Go Squid, and i feel like the whole issue between the ML there and his friends in the past was really weird for ML to hold such a passionate grudge over. but if a modern drama doesn't have a thriller element (lovely runner, strong woman do bong soon) they kind have to ham things up.

though personally, i don't feel they are going overboard here. he doesn't have a problem with her going, if he did then he wouldn't have continued pursuing her. i think the issue stems from herself and how her ex treated her regarding the issue, shooting down the idea early on in their relationship and then calling her selfish and a terrible partner when she brought it up again.
on top of that from her perspective her ex bf being away a lot and basically being a long distance relationship that failed, it feels decently realistic to me that she would be scared to try again and worried about being too selfish :/
